### Changed Defaults — Hermetic Build Migration

The Saltfern toolchain now builds all first-party targets under the hermetic Ovenbird build system by default. Plugin authors should note that network access during builds is disabled, ambient toolchains are ignored, and all dependencies must be declared explicitly in the manifest. Plugins built against the old defaults will need the settings below.

config for yajep-tafof:
[rusath]
team = julmir
access_code = ac_fe37fd
host = rusath.novactech.test
port = 8000
owner = pelmir.weneth
peer = oliwyn.olvarqdyn.internal

Hi sales leads — quick rundown before Thursday's review. Summit is Pellardo Software's new top subscription tier: priority support, advanced reporting, and the Cartwheel analytics add-on bundled in. Early pilots in the Redmarsh accounts show decent uptake, especially where renewals were wobbly. Pricing lands about 40% above the current Plus tier, with an annual-only commitment at launch. Expect objection-handling material next week. One thing before you start pitching: read the confidential note below and keep it to this group.

confidential, kagup-bafog: Fraaxax Group is in early talks to buy Soroxox Group for about $343.8 million. The Olidor launch date is June 14, and nothing goes to the press before then. Legal wants the Aldmirek Logistics term sheet signed before July 23.

## Deployment

The Brindlemart catalog service invalidates its cache on deploy by bumping a version key; stale entries expire within 90 seconds. Do not flush the cache manually during rollout — it causes a thundering herd against the pricing backend. Reviewers should confirm the invalidation step runs after migrations. The cache layer is configured with the following values.

settings of fafog-haduf:
ZORIX_PIN=4648
ZORIX_METRICS_HOST=metrics.zorix.paliqsys.corp
ZORIX_LOG_LEVEL=info
ZORIX_TENANT=druix